Transaction ed014a496343796453110f408b0583caa794c16c02cfeb5f70ebf593ca16ce86

4 Input
1 Outputs
  • ed014a496343796453110f408b0583caa794c16c02cfeb5f70ebf593ca16ce86:0
  • value  47942368
    address  39Gd6GmLo3vz6WZkCgWqzR6hd1CzP4bwsJ